About your tutor

Hello! I’m Hadia, a PhD student with a deep passion for teaching Mathematics across all school and college levels. With several years of tutoring experience, I’ve had the opportunity to work with diverse learners, helping each one unlock their potential and build confidence in math. My teaching philosophy is rooted in the belief that math is not just about numbers and formulas—it's about logical thinking, problem-solving, and understanding how the world works. I focus on making math relatable and engaging by connecting abstract concepts to real-life situations. Whether it’s through visual aids, interactive examples, or step-by-step strategies, I tailor my approach to suit each student’s unique learning style. I strive to create a positive and encouraging learning environment where students feel safe to make mistakes, ask questions, and truly understand the “why” behind the “how.” I’m committed to helping students move beyond memorization and develop a deep, lasting understanding of mathematical concepts. Teaching is more than a job for me it’s a passion. There’s nothing more fulfilling than watching students overcome challenges, gain confidence, and achieve their academic goals. With the right support, I truly believe that every student can succeed in math. Let’s team up and turn math into a strength you can be proud of!

Hadia tutored Vrishank on algebra, focusing on the difference of two squares, laws of indices, and exponential equations. Hadia identified errors in Vrishank's worksheet and reviewed key rules, providing examples and practice. For exponential equations, the main strategy taught was equating exponents after making the bases the same. Hadia assigned two mandatory assignments (expansion and exponential equations) and a non-compulsory percentage assignment, emphasizing their importance for identifying areas needing further review before moving on to scientific notation. She also recommended memorizing common powers.
